In this episode you’ll learn:
03:11 Overview of Nicole’s entrepreneurial journey
06:55 The importance of having a supportive tribe
10:18 How to use a diagnosis to guide and empower you as a parent
12:04 Navigating grief as a Special Needs Parent
15:04 Emotional regulation for parents
21:21 How our parents' guidance shaped us into a better parent
23:09 What makes motherhood worthwhile
24:13 Embracing your identity beyond motherhood
Key Quotes
13:50 It's not about sharing their interests, but rather embracing and celebrating their individuality, so that they can find their own path to happiness and fulfillment. - Nicole Griffin
14:22 Your child is a unique individual with their own path to walk. They are not you and their journey will not mirror your own. - Nicole Griffin
18:16 Regardless of what we do, our children will live their lives on their own terms. As parents, our job is to offer guidance and support, not to control and dictate their path. - Leashia Arrowsmith
20:18 You don’t have to be great at everything but you just have to give it a go. - Nicole Griffin
23:28 Everything your child is going through, your also going through and it's always a chance to learn, grow, change and evolve in some way. - Nicole Griffin
24:13 Being a mother is a significant part of who you are, but it's not the entirety of your identity. You are an individual with your own dreams and aspirations, and it's important to prioritize self-care and personal growth alongside your parenting responsibilities.

Nicole is the owner of Grif&Co, a wife & mum to 4 children.
Along her motherhood journey she has learned a lot through the various challenges she has faced while raising her kids. Her three eldest children have each gone through the process of diagnosis of various medical & behavioural issues that have been a source of both hardship & growth throughout the years.
Nicole has shared her journey with others on a number of platforms but most recently has found a passion for sewing & creating & as such, Grif&Co was launched. Making handmade clothing & accessories for babies & children & also supporting mums through motherhood via her blog & providing handmade self care products & useful items to make mums lives easier.
